Romanian Shepherd dogs have been protecting livestock for centuries, with origins tracing back to Mesopotamia. These dogs are known for their resilience in harsh mountain climates. Shepherds rely on them for protection, as they are attuned to human behavior and have a cooperative nature. Traditional shepherding practices include milking sheep and making cheese, which also feeds the dogs. During summer, the flock is most vulnerable to wolf attacks, but the dogs' vigilance, especially at night, ensures the safety of the livestock. The shepherd can rest easy knowing his flock is well-guarded.
